What To Do Before Hiring Staley’s
To ensure a smooth engagement, customers should:
- Request a written estimate with itemized labor and parts for transparency.
- Confirm warranty terms and service guarantees in writing.
- Ask for references or case studies relevant to your project type and home size.
Preparing a clear list of symptoms, photos, and timing can help technicians diagnose quickly and accurately, reducing the risk of scope creep.
